Southern Africa in a Nutshell Safari, BeachGuest User11 November 2019South Africa, Namibia, Botswana, Zambia, Zimbabwe, Malawi, Mozambique, Madagascar, Mauritius, Lesotho, SwazilandComment
Coastal Paradise BeachJames Walsh05 July 2019coastal retreat, vilanculos, Mozambique, town tourComment